#BAF9BB Hex Color Code

#BAF9BB

The Hexadecimal Color #BAF9BB is a contrast shade of Pale Green. #BAF9BB RGB value is rgb(186, 249, 187). RGB Color Model of #BAF9BB consists of 72% red, 97% green and 73% blue. HSL color Mode of #BAF9BB has 121°(degrees) Hue, 84% Saturation and 85% Lightness. #BAF9BB color has an wavelength of 543.81481nm approximately. The nearest Web Safe Color of #BAF9BB is #CCFFCC. The Closest Small Hexadecimal Code of #BAF9BB is #BFB. The Closest Color to #BAF9BB is #98FB98. Official Name of #BAF9BB Hex Code is Madang. CMYK (Cyan Magenta Yellow Black) of #BAF9BB is 25 Cyan 0 Magenta 25 Yellow 2 Black and #BAF9BB CMY is 25, 0, 25. Triad, Tetrad and SplitComplement of #BAF9BB

Triad, Tetrad, and Split Complement are hex color schemes used in art to create harmonious combinations of colors.

The Triad color scheme involves three colors that are evenly spaced around the color wheel, forming an equilateral triangle. The primary triad includes red, blue, and yellow, while other triadic combinations can be formed with different hues. Triad color schemes offer a balanced contrast and are versatile for creating vibrant and dynamic visuals.

The Tetrad color scheme incorporates four colors that are arranged in two complementary pairs. These pairs create a rectangle or square shape on the color wheel. The primary Tetrad includes two sets of complementary colors, such as red and green, and blue and orange. This scheme provides a wide range of color options and allows for both strong contrast and harmonious blends.

The Split Complement color scheme involves a base color paired with the two colors adjacent to its complementary color on the color wheel. For example, if the base color is blue, the Split Complement scheme would include blue, yellow-orange, and red-orange. This combination maintains contrast while offering a more subtle and balanced alternative to a complementary color scheme.
